Getting into the staking business

Got into the staking business today - I've taken on a horse by the name of SYLAER, who will be grinding 27/45 man SNGs on FTP for me, with a 50/50 split of profits. The terms of the contract include the stipulation that he must play at least 75 games a week, and he will start at the $5 games. I will decide whether or not to move him up on a week-to-week basis. He played a quick 4 games tonight to start the stake, and in those 4 he already won a 27 man and mincashed another 27 man. I'm really excited about this stake and I have a good feeling that it'll be profitable for both of us.
